Notices of Material Changes. Contractor shall notify the Board of Trustees in writing within five (5) business days of any material changes in senior officers providing or overseeing the services identified herein, significant legal actions instituted against Contractor, or any significant investigations, examinations, or other proceedings commenced by any governmental agency including, but not limited to, investigations by any bar association, relating to the kinds of services identified herein. Notices required in this section shall be served on TRS by registered or certified mail.

Notices of Material Changes. Until Closing, the Vendor shall promptly notify S&N in writing of (i) any material change (actual, anticipated, contemplated or, to the Knowledge of the Vendor, threatened, financial or otherwise) in its business, operations, affairs, assets, capitalization, financial condition, prospects, licenses, permits, rights, privileges or liabilities, whether contractual or otherwise, or of any change in any representation or warranty provided by the Vendor or by the Subsidiary in this Agreement which change is or may be of such a nature to render any representation or warranty misleading or untrue in any material respect and the Vendor shall in good faith discuss with S&N any change in circumstances (actual, anticipated, contemplated, or to the Knowledge of the Vendor threatened) which is of such a nature that there may be a reasonable question as to whether notice needs to be given to S&N pursuant to this provision and (ii) any breach by the Vendor or by the Subsidiary of any covenant, obligation or agreement contained in this Agreement.

  • Notification of Material Changes The Advisor also agrees to give the Company prior written notice of any proposed material change in its Trading Approach and agrees not to make any material change in such Trading Approach (as applied to the Company) over the objection of the Company, it being understood that the Advisor shall be free to institute non-material changes in its Trading Approach (as applied to the Company) without prior written notification. Without limiting the generality of the foregoing, refinements to the Advisor’s Trading Approach and the deletion (but not the addition) of Commodities (other than the addition of Commodities then being traded (i) on organized domestic commodities exchanges, (ii) on foreign commodities exchanges recognized by the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(the “CFTC”) as providing customer protections comparable to those provided on domestic exchanges or (iii) in the interbank foreign currency market) to or from the Advisor’s Trading Approach, shall not be deemed a material change in the Advisor’s Trading Approach, and prior approval of the Company shall not be required therefor. The utilization of forward markets in addition to those enumerated in the Advisor’s Disclosure Document attached hereto as Exhibit C would be deemed a material change to the Advisor’s Trading Approach and prior approval shall be required therefor. Subject to adequate assurances of confidentiality, the Advisor agrees that it will discuss with the Company upon request any trading methods, programs, systems or strategies used by it for trading customer accounts which differ from the Trading Approach used for the Company, provided that nothing contained in this Agreement shall require the Advisor to disclose what it deems to be proprietary or confidential information.

  • Absence of Material Changes Subsequent to the respective dates as of which information is given in the Registration Statement, the Prospectus and the Disclosure Package, and except as may be otherwise stated or incorporated by reference in the Registration Statement, the Prospectus and the Disclosure Package, there has not been (i) any Material Adverse Effect, (ii) any transaction which is material to the Company and its subsidiaries taken as a whole, (iii) any obligation, direct or contingent (including any off-balance sheet obligations), incurred by the Company or any of its subsidiaries, which is material to the Company and its subsidiaries taken as a whole, (iv) any dividend or distribution of any kind declared, paid or made on the capital stock of the Company, or (v) any change in the capital stock (other than a change in the number of outstanding shares of Common Stock due to the issuance of shares upon the exercise of outstanding options or warrants or the conversion of convertible indebtedness) or material change in the short-term debt or long-term debt of the Company or any of its subsidiaries (other than upon conversion of convertible indebtedness) or any issuance of options, warrants, convertible securities or other rights to purchase the capital stock (other than grants of stock options under the Company’s stock option plans existing on the date hereof) of the Company or any of its subsidiaries.

  • Notice of Material Developments Each Party shall give prompt written notice to the other Parties of: (a) any material variances in any of its representations or warranties contained in Articles 2 or 3 above, as the case may be (the Disclosure Schedule); (b) any breach of any covenant or agreement hereunder by such Party; and (c) any other material development which adversely affects the ability of such Party to consummate the transactions contemplated by this Agreement.

  • Material Changes Except as contemplated in the Prospectus, or disclosed in the Company’s reports filed with the Commission, there shall not have been any material adverse change in the authorized capital stock of the Company or any Material Adverse Effect or any development that would reasonably be expected to cause a Material Adverse Effect, or a downgrading in or withdrawal of the rating assigned to any of the Company’s securities (other than asset backed securities) by any rating organization or a public announcement by any rating organization that it has under surveillance or review its rating of any of the Company’s securities (other than asset backed securities), the effect of which, in the case of any such action by a rating organization described above, in the reasonable judgment of the Agent (without relieving the Company of any obligation or liability it may otherwise have), is so material as to make it impracticable or inadvisable to proceed with the offering of the Placement Shares on the terms and in the manner contemplated in the Prospectus.

  • Notices; Reports Company and Company Sub will promptly notify Parent of any event of which Company or Company Sub obtains knowledge which has had or may have a Material Adverse Effect, or in the event that Company or Company Sub determines that it is unable to fulfill, or that any event has occurred which is reasonably likely to prevent the fulfillment of, any of the conditions to the performance of Parent’s obligations hereunder, as set forth in Articles 9 or 11 herein, and Company or Company Sub will furnish Parent (i) as soon as available, and in any event within one Business Day after it is mailed or delivered to the Board of Directors of Company or committees thereof, any report by Company for submission to the Board of Directors of Company or committees thereof, provided, however, that Company need not furnish to Parent communications of Company’s or Company Sub’s legal counsel regarding Company’s or Company Sub’s rights and obligations under this Agreement or the transactions contemplated hereby, or other communication incident to Company’s or Company Sub’s actions pursuant to Section 6.3 hereof (except as required by Section 6.3 or Section 6.9), or books, records and documents covered by confidentiality agreements or the attorney-client privilege, or which are attorneys’ work product, (ii) prior to sending or filing same, all proxy statements, information statements, financial statements, reports, letters and communications sent by Company to its stockholders or other security holders, and all reports filed by Company with the SEC or other Governmental Entities, and (iii) such other existing reports as Parent may reasonably request relating to Company or Company Sub. No notification delivered pursuant to this Section 6.7 shall affect the representations, warranties, covenants or agreements of the parties or the conditions to the obligations of the parties under this Agreement.
